How Our Condo Water Damage Restoration Service Actually Works
When you call us for condo water damage restoration, our team will arrive quickly to assess the situation and develop a customized plan to restore your property. We’ll work closely with you to ensure that every step of the process meets your needs and exceeds your expectations.
Step 1: Assessment and Planning
We’ll inspect your condo to identify the source and extent of the water damage, and develop a plan to restore your property to its pre-damaged condition. Our team will work with you to focus on the most critical areas of damage and create a schedule for the restoration process.
Step 2: Water Extraction and Drying
Our crew will use advanced equipment to extract standing water from your condo, and then use specialized drying equipment to remove moisture from walls, floors, and ceilings. This step is crucial in preventing further damage and mold growth.
Step 3: Cleaning and Disinfecting
We’ll thoroughly clean and disinfect all affected areas to remove dirt, grime, and bacteria. Our team will use eco-friendly cleaning products to ensure your condo is safe and healthy for you and your family.
Step 4: Repairs and Reconstruction
Once the cleaning and disinfecting process is complete, our team will make any necessary repairs to walls, floors, and ceilings. We’ll also reconstruct any damaged areas to match the original construction.
Step 5: Final Inspection and Completion
We’ll conduct a final inspection to ensure that your condo has been fully restored to its pre-damaged condition. Our team will also provide you with a comprehensive report outlining the work completed and any recommendations for future maintenance.

Warning Signs You Need Condo Water Damage Restoration
Early detection is key to preventing costly repairs and reducing disruption to your daily life. Keep an eye out for these warning signs that show you need condo water damage restoration:
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away
Unpleasant odors in your condo can be a sign of hidden moisture and potential mold growth. If you notice persistent musty smells, it’s time to call in the professionals.
Water Stains on Walls and Ceilings
Water stains on walls and ceilings can show a leak or water damage. Don’t ignore these signs, they can lead to costly repairs and even health hazards.
Warped or Buckled Flooring
Warped or buckled flooring can be a sign of water damage or moisture accumulation. Our team can help you restore your flooring to its original condition.
Discolored or Fading Paint
Discolored or fading paint can show water damage or moisture issues. Don’t wait, call us to assess and restore your condo’s paint and finishes.
Peeling or Cracking Caulk and Grout
Peeling or cracking caulk and grout can be a sign of water damage or moisture accumulation. Our team can help you restore your condo’s caulking and grouting.
Unpleasant Odors from Your HVAC System
Unpleasant odors from your HVAC system can show a buildup of bacteria and mold. Our team can help you clean and disinfect your HVAC system to remove these odors.

Condo Water Damage Restoration Cost in Hewlett, NY
The cost of condo water damage restoration in Hewlett, NY can vary dep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ions. Our team will provide you with a free estimate and work closely with you to ensure that every step of the process meets your needs and exceeds your expectations.
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Water extraction and drying | $500 – $2,500 | The size of the affected area and the severity of the damage. |
| Cleaning and disinfecting | $200 – $1,000 | The extent of the damage and the type of surfaces affected. |
| Repairs and reconstruction | $1,000 – $5,000 | The extent of the damage and the materials required for repairs. |
| Final inspection and completion | $100 – $500 | The complexity of the restoration project and the number of inspections required. |
| More services (e.g., mold remediation, odor removal) | $500 – $2,000 | The extent of the damage and the type of services required. |

Common Questions About Condo Water Damage Restoration
What is the typical timeline for condo water damage restoration?
Our team will work with you to develop a customized restoration plan, but typical timelines range from 3-5 days for small to medium-sized projects. Larger projects may take longer, depending on the extent of the damage and the number of inspections required.
Is condo water damage restoration covered by insurance?
Yes, most insurance policies cover condo water damage restoration. Our team will work closely with your insurance company to ensure a smooth claims process and reduce your out-of-pocket expenses.
What are the health risks associated with condo water damage?
Exposure to standing water and moisture can lead to health hazards such as mold growth, bacterial contamination, and respiratory issues. Our team will take every precaution to ensure your safety and health throughout the restoration process.
Can I prevent condo water damage?
Yes, regular maintenance and inspections can help prevent condo water damage. Our team can provide you with recommendations for maintaining your condo’s plumbing, HVAC system, and roofing to prevent water damage.
What equipment does your team use for condo water damage restoration?
We use advanced equipment such as dehumidifiers, air scrubbers, and specialized drying equipment to remove moisture and prevent further damage. Our team will also use eco-friendly cleaning products to ensure your condo is safe and healthy for you and your family.
